WINTER FIRE is firing up to be a cracker of a night. So wrap up warmly and bring all the family for an evening of fire, fun, food and fireworks.

On the night you will be able to wander between 12 fire drums, around which different activities will take place including music, story-telling and poetry readings.

There will be marshmallows to toast, hot chocolate to warm you up and fire twirlers to watch.

The Circle Dance Band and dancers will start at 5.20 pm so remember to come early. There will be a great fireworks display followed by a bonfire constructed by Deputy Mayor, Michael Kelly.

Arts Deloraine, Rotary, Apex, Lions, Fire Brigade, SES and the Show Society are all working together to make this an evening to remember and one which we hope will become an annual event.

A raffle will be drawn on the night with a prize of a patio firepot made out of sheet metal. Raffle tickets can be bought early at Elemental Art Space or can be purchased on the night.

The gate will open at the Deloraine Showgrounds at 5 pm Saturday, 27th June with a $10 entry fee for adults. Entry for children is free but all children must be accompanied by adults as this is a fire event.

Please bring a torch as lighting is limited and you will want to find your car again.

Most events will take place behind the Furmage Building.
